Purpose

The Graduate School in cooperation with the Office of the Vice President for Research has developed the Purdue University Responsible Conduct of Research (RCR) program. The purpose of this program is to inculcate, promote and sustain an environment of research integrity in all graduate students, staff and faculty at Purdue University.

Purdue University Graduate school recommends a multi-pronged approach to promote Responsible Conduct of Research:

a. Attending workshops,

b. Online training/tutorial modules, and

c. Meeting Departmental or College expectations in Responsible Conduct of Research


Responsible Conduct of Research

Means that one is honest in his/her academic and research endeavors, and strives to do the right thing by adhering to the best and highest ethical standards.
